
Job Description
REQUIREMENTS:
- Total Experience 6+ years
- Strong hands-on experience as a Microsoft Dynamics AX/D365 Finance & Operations Technical Consultant.
- Experience working with Dynamics AX 2012 (R2/R3) and/or Dynamics 365 Finance & Operations.
- Strong knowledge of X++ development and Object-Oriented Programming concepts.
- Good understanding of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) phases and implementation methodologies.
- Proven experience in Dynamics AX/D365 technical implementations and full project lifecycle delivery.
- Experience with technical upgrades from AX 2009/AX 2012 to Dynamics 365 Finance & Operations.
- Strong knowledge of Dynamics AX integrations using Web Services, DIXF, DMF, OData, SOAP, REST, JSON, SSIS, Direct SQL, and Azure Logic Apps.
- Hands-on experience with SSRS report development and customization.
- Strong knowledge of Microsoft SQL Server (2012+), including T-SQL, stored procedures, functions, views, SSIS, and SSAS.
- Experience with complex data migration, B2B integrations, and inbound/outbound data interfaces.
- Experience configuring workflows, batch processing framework, security, and AX/D365 environment setup.
- Experience with ALM, TFS, Azure DevOps, and release management processes.
- Strong understanding of .NET, Exchange, SharePoint Services, and the overall Dynamics AX technology stack.
- Experience in performance tuning, code reviews, and implementing best practices.
- Ability to manage multiple tasks, meet deadlines, and communicate effectively with technical and business teams.
- Experience delivering 4–5 end-to-end Dynamics AX/D365 Finance & Operations implementation projects.
- Microsoft certification in Development, Extensions, and Deployment for Dynamics 365 Finance & Operations is preferred.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Design, develop, customize, and support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012/Dynamics 365 Finance & Operations (D365 F&O) technical solutions.
- Participate in end-to-end implementation projects, including requirement analysis, technical design, development, testing, deployment, and post-go-live support.
- Develop customizations, extensions, and enhancements using X++ following Microsoft best practices.
- Perform technical upgrades and migrations from Dynamics AX 2009/AX 2012 to Dynamics 365 Finance & Operations.
- Develop and maintain integrations using Web Services, DIXF, DMF, OData, SOAP, REST APIs, JSON, SSIS, Direct SQL, and Azure Logic Apps.
- Execute complex data migration activities using DIXF, DMF, and third-party migration tools.
- Customize and develop SSRS reports based on business requirements.
- Configure and support D365 technical components, including workflows, batch framework, security roles, user groups, and database connections.
- Manage development environments, release processes, and deployments using ALM, TFS, and Azure DevOps.
- Perform code reviews, performance tuning, debugging, and code profiling to ensure optimized solutions.
- Develop and optimize SQL Server components, including stored procedures, functions, and views.
- Collaborate with functional consultants, architects, business users, and technical teams to deliver scalable solutions.
- Prepare technical design documents, deployment guides, and support documentation.
- Follow Microsoft development standards, coding guidelines, and security best practices.
